Understanding This Legal Service

A breach occurs when one party fails to honor the terms, dates, or contingencies set in a real estate purchase contract.

Common remedies include specific performance, damages for financial harm, or contract termination, depending on the breach and contract provisions.

Definition and Explanation

A real estate purchase contract is a legally binding agreement detailing price, closing date, contingencies, and other terms. A breach triggers potential damages and remedies under California law.

Key Elements and Processes

Elements include contract terms, notice of breach, available remedies, deadlines, and evidence of damages. The process typically begins with review, followed by negotiation, mediation, or litigation as needed.

Key Terms and Glossary

This glossary defines common terms you may encounter in breach of real estate purchase contract cases in Brisbane.

Offer and Acceptance

The moment a seller accepts a binding offer, a contract is formed, creating obligations for both sides.

Contingencies

Conditions that must be satisfied before closing, such as financing or inspections; breaches can occur if contingencies aren’t met.

Damages

Monetary compensation intended to cover losses caused by the breach.

Specific Performance

A court order requiring the parties to complete the purchase as agreed.
